  3. 3. Machine Learning Algorithms for Improved Glaucoma Diagnosis

    Author : Dimitrios Bizios; Oftalmologi (Malmö); []
    Keywords : MEDICIN OCH HÄLSOVETENSKAP; MEDICAL AND HEALTH SCIENCES;

    Abstract : Primary open angle glaucoma, one of the leading causes of blindness in the world, constitutes a slow progressing condition characterized by damage to the optic nerve and retinal nerve fibre layer, and results in visual field defects afflicting the visual function. Highly specific and sensitive diagnostic tests able to detect the clinically significant glaucomatous changes in the structure of the nerve fiber layer and visual field are therefore required for the early detection and management of this disease.   4. 4. Assessing Risks of Glaucoma

    Author : Sigridur Oskarsdottir; Oftalmologi (Malmö); []
    Keywords : MEDICIN OCH HÄLSOVETENSKAP; MEDICAL AND HEALTH SCIENCES; Glaucoma; Glaucoma stages; Ocular hypertension; Prevalence; Visual impairment; Prediction model; Lifetime risk; Undetected glaucoma; Screening;

    Abstract : Glaucoma is a potentially blinding disease where the affected individual often firstnotices symptoms when the disease has reached a late stage. If glaucoma is detectedearly e.g., at screening, the risk for visual impairment can be reduced. READ MORE
